@@ -314,7 +314,7 @@ React 19 includes all of the React Server Components features included from the
Bundler and framework support for React Server Components can be built on React 19, but the underlying APIs will not follow semver and may break between minors in React 19.x.
To support React Server Components, we recommend pinning to a specific React version, or using the Canary release. We will continue working with bundlers and frameworks to stablize support for React Server Components in future versions.
To support React Server Components, we recommend pinning to a specific React version, or using the Canary release. We will continue working with bundlers and frameworks to stabilize support for React Server Components in future versions.
